코드 압축기 가이드
코드 압축기 설명
JavaScript, CSS 및 HTML 코드를 압축하고 최적화합니다. 불필요한 문자를 제거하여 파일 크기를 줄이고 웹사이트 로딩 속도를 향상시킵니다.
주요 특징
다중 언어 지원: JavaScript, CSS 및 HTML을 한 곳에서 압축합니다.
크기 감소: 주석, 여분의 공백 및 줄바꿈을 제거하여 최대 압축을 구현합니다.
실시간 통계: 절약된 용량(KB 및 백분율)을 정확하게 확인합니다.
클릭 한 번으로 작업: 복잡한 설정 없이 빠르고 효율적인 처리가 가능합니다.
사용 방법
1
소스 언어(JS, CSS 또는 HTML)를 선택합니다.
2
압축하지 않은 소스 코드를 에디터에 붙여넣습니다.
3
예시 (데모) 버튼을 클릭하여 스크립트의 일반적인 압축 결과를 확인합니다.
4
압축을 클릭하여 압축된 버전을 가져옵니다.
5
출력을 복사하거나 가능한 경우 다운로드 옵션을 사용합니다.
자주 묻는 질문
Q. 압축이 로직을 변경하나요?
아니요, 물리적 표현에만 영향을 미칩니다. 코드의 동작은 동일하게 유지됩니다.
Q. 나중에 다시 원래대로 돌릴 수 있나요?
'Prettify'를 사용하여 코드를 다시 읽기 좋게 만들 수는 있지만, 원래의 주석과 서식은 압축 과정에서 영구적으로 손실됩니다.
활용 사례
- 운영 환경 배포: 서버에 업로드하기 전에 자산을 압축하여 PageSpeed 점수를 높입니다.
- 코드 조각 공유: 문자 수 제한이 있는 플랫폼에서 공유하기 위해 코드 크기를 줄입니다.
- 대역폭 절약: 트래픽이 많은 애플리케이션의 데이터 전송 비용을 낮춥니다.
기술적 심층 분석
코드 압축은 코드의 어휘 구조를 분석하고 인간의 가독성에는 필요하지만 기계는 무시하는 토큰을 제거함으로써 작동합니다. 여기에는 공백, 줄바꿈 및 블록 주석이 포함됩니다.
제한 사항
- 이 도구는 기본 압축을 수행합니다. 변수 이름 변경과 같은 고급 JavaScript 최적화의 경우 Terser 또는 UglifyJS와 같은 특수 빌드 도구 사용을 고려하십시오.
3M
검토 Tool3M Editorial Team
업데이트 April 25, 2026